Duncan Supply Company, Inc. is an industry leader in distributing a wide range of refrigeration, air conditioning, heating, and food service equipment and supplies to customers throughout Indiana, Ohio, Northern Kentucky, and Central Illinois. We are a highly trusted service-first organization due to the care and commitment of our team of dedicated employees. We are growing and have an open position for an Accounts Receivable Specialist.

Our Accounts Receivable Specialist is responsible for processing the company's accounts receivable transactions assisting the accounts receivable manager. The Accounts Receivable Associate will work closely with the accounts receivable team and other departments to invoice customers, record payments, monitor overdue accounts, and work to resolve any payment discrepancies or issues.
